           Experts(专家) say that students usually need eight to ten hours' sleep at night, but most Chinese
    students do not get enough sleep. Some Chinese parents are usually glad to see their children studying
    late. They will think their children work very hard. But not all parents think about this. Once a mother
    told us that every morning her l0-year-old boy puts up one finger with 'his eyes still closed, begging(乞求)
    one more minute to sleep. Like thousands of students "Early Bird " in China,  he has to get up before six
    every morning.
           A report shows that if they don't have a good night's sleep, students seem to he weaker than they
    should be. Many students have fallen asleep (入睡)during classes. Too much homework is not the only
    reason(原因) why students stay up late. Some watch TV or play games late into the night.
           Experts ever say that students should develop (养成)good study habits. So some clever students
    never study late, and they are able to work well in class.
